码农知识堂 - 1000bd
  •   Python
  •   PHP
  •   JS/TS
  •   JAVA
  •   C/C++
  •   C#
  •   GO
  •   Kotlin
  •   Swift
  • 【网络安全 --- 工具安装】Centos 7 详细安装过程及xshell,FTP等工具的安装(提供资源)


    分享一个非常详细的网络安全笔记,是我学习网安过程中用心写的,可以点开以下链接获取:

    超详细的网络安全笔记

    二,文件包含漏洞详解

    VMware虚拟机的安装教程如下,如没有安装,可以参考这篇博客安装(提供资源)

    【网络安全 --- 工具安装】VMware 16.0 详细安装过程(提供资源)-CSDN博客【网络安全 --- 工具安装】VMware 16.0 详细安装过程(提供资源)https://blog.csdn.net/m0_67844671/article/details/133609717

    一,资源下载

    CentOS 7 镜像

    shell 远程连接工具

    xftp 文件上传工具

    下载资源网盘地址如下:

    百度网盘 请输入提取码百度网盘为您提供文件的网络备份、同步和分享服务。空间大、速度快、安全稳固,支持教育网加速,支持手机端。注册使用百度网盘即可享受免费存储空间icon-default.png?t=N7T8https://pan.baidu.com/s/1FjxYvfCbHGysBZ_i_AduIw?pwd=1234

    二,CentOS 安装

    本次演示以Windows为例

    注意:如果你是苹果mac的M1 pro芯片的电脑,安装centos7虚拟机就按照这个文章来:

    mac pro M1(ARM)安装:VMWare Fusion及linux(centos7/ubuntu)(一)-腾讯云开发者社区-腾讯云mac发布了m1芯片,其强悍的性能收到很多开发者的追捧,但是也因为其架构的更换,导致很多软件或环境的安装成了问题,今天就来谈谈如何在m1中安装linux虚拟机icon-default.png?t=N7T8https://cloud.tencent.com/developer/article/2150583
    centos官网在国外,所以下载起来肯定是很慢,国内有很多镜像地址,用国内的下载即可,比如清华大 学开源软件镜像站:
    清华大学开源软件镜像站 | Tsinghua Open Source Mirror清华大学开源软件镜像站,致力于为国内和校内用户提供高质量的开源软件镜像、Linux 镜像源服务,帮助用户更方便地获取开源软件。本镜像站由清华大学 TUNA 协会负责运行维护。icon-default.png?t=N7T8https://mirrors.tuna.tsinghua.edu.cn/
    找到合适的版本下载即可

     不过,这些镜像我也准备好了,从网盘下载下来用即可

    虽然最新的已经到8.x版本了,但是企业现在用的最多的还是7.x版本。我们使用7.8.2003即可:
    centos的ios镜像下载地址 :
    https://mirrors.tuna.tsinghua.edu.cn/centos-vault/7.8.2003/isos/x86_64/CentOS-7-x86_64-DVD-2003.isoicon-default.png?t=N7T8https://mirrors.tuna.tsinghua.edu.cn/centos-vault/7.8.2003/isos/x86_64/CentOS-7-x86_64-DVD-2003.iso
    不过我已经给大家准备好了,资源下载以后解压打开如下:

    接下来开始安装 

    1,首先创建一个专门放虚拟机的文件夹

    我在E盘创建了个all_system文件夹,放安装的虚拟机

    2,打开VM,创建新的虚拟机

    3,选择典型,下一步

    4,稍后安装操作系统,然后下一步

     5,选择Linux ,然后选择CentOS 7  64位,下一步

     6,给虚拟机起名字,然后选择刚才新建的文件夹

     7,磁盘大小根据你电脑剩余容量自己给(后来可以增加的)

     8,点击完成即可

     9,打开‘编辑虚拟机设置’

     10,选择下载好的或者我提供的 CentOS-7.8-x86_64-DVD-2003.iso 文件 然后点确定

     11,点击,开机次虚拟机

     12,字体变为白色表示选中了,选择第一个(上下键可上下选中) 按回车即可

    13,然后就是等待,最后如下,选择中文

    14,如下,默认系统自动安装的软件很少,作为服务器来讲的话,软件需要安装的少一些,但是为了我们自 ,己学习研究,我们还是安装的多一些

    15,如下,下面GNOME就是桌面的意思,我们学linux不用桌面,用了桌面学不到精髓,而且桌面本身也是 个程序,会消耗系统资源和性能,所以企业服务器上基本都不会安装桌面

     16,如下,我们设定分区,跟windows一样,Linux也是有分区的。

    17,如下,默认是自动分区的,但是默认分区分出来的效果不好,该大不大,该小不小的,我们还是手动分区。

    18,如下  

     19,在linux下不像windows似的,有C盘、D盘..等盘符,它只有一个根盘符,就是 / ,剩下的目录都是再它之下的子目录。先将所有空间给 / 

    20,然后点击完成 

    21,可能会提出如下警告,说我们这么分不太合理,没事,先忽略,直接点击完成 

    22,还会有这样的提示,点击接受即可 

     23 ,如下,关闭Kdump功能,因为对我们现在学习来讲,没什么用,反而占用内存。

    24,取消勾选,然后点击完成 

     25,接下来设置网络和主机名

    26,打开以后点击完成 

     27,接下来就点击开始安装即可: 

     28,如下,安装中,安装过程中设置个密码,Linux默认有一个root用户,类似于我们windows的 administrator用户,是超级管理员用户,我们上来就只有这么一个root用户,给它设置一个密码,不然 一会进入系统的时候还是会让你先设置密码。

    29,设置完成以后按两次完成 (弱密码需要两次点击完成按钮)

     30,再次点击完成即可

     

    31,密码设置完成,等待安装系统安装完成即可

    32,系统终于安装完成,点击重启 

    33,重启完了,输入账号root

    34,输入你设置的密码

    35,系统安装完成

    36,安装完成以后最好做过快照,以免被损坏时可以恢复到现在安装后的模样,拍快照的话需要关机以后再拍

    可以用命令关机

    shutdown -h now

    37,拍摄快照 

    38,然后就点击拍摄快照

    39,这样就完成了,如果以后系统被损坏了,或者想回到刚安装的样子们可以通过恢复快照来完成 

    40,选择想要恢复的快照以后,点击下面的‘转到’ 

    41,选择‘是’即可,就回到了我们拍快照时的系统状态

    我们发现,Linux系统字很小,总是这样操作很不方便,接下来安装个远程连接工具xshell 

    三,xshell工具的安装

    3-1 工具下载及安装

    在官网下载即可,地址:

    XSHELL - NetSarang Websiteicon-default.png?t=N7T8https://www.xshell.com/zh/xshell/

    如下,大家输入一下邮箱,后面安装xshell的过程中需要输入这个邮箱:  

    工具也已经提供了,资源里有,从网盘里下载即可

    1,双击安装 

    2,下一步

    3,接受协议以后下一步 

    4,更改路径以后下一步(尽量别默认安装在C盘) 

    5,默认即可,点击安装

    6,点击完成 

     7,点击确定

    8,点击确定,进行更新,否则不然用 

    9,下一步即可 

    10,下一步

    11,完成 

    12,桌面上有了快捷方式,双击打开 

    13,有邮箱则输入账号,邮箱登录,没有则注册 

    14,确定即可

    15,安装成功了 

     3-2 连接

    我们选看一下刚才linux 系统的IP地址 

    ip addr 命令查看IP地址

    IP地址为 192.168.220.137 

    3-2-1 窗口连接

     先填写这些信息,名称随便

    然后左侧选中用户身份验证 ,填写用户名和密码然后点击连接即可

     接受并保存

    已经连上了 

     可以用了

     3-2-2 命令行连接

    格式 

            ssh 用户名@IP地址

            ssh root@192.168.220.137 

    输入ssh 远程连接命令按回车 

     填写密码然后确定

    已经连接上了,可以执行命令了 

    如果你想从物理机跟Linux系统之间传资料怎么办,这时就需要安装一个FTP资源传输工具,可以很方便的进行资源传输 

    四,安装Xftp上传文件

    如果你想自己上传一个执行文件到服务器上,我们可以使用xftp工具,如下

    大家就不用下载了,工具里面我给大家也提供了,直接安装那个即可
    1,双击安装

     2,下一步

    3,我接受协议,下一步

    4,修改默认安装地址以后下一步 

    5,点击安装 

     6,点击完成

     7,确定,进行更新

    8,确定

    9,下一步 

    10,下一步

    11,完成

    12,这就安装完成了,接下来点击这里即可,xshell会自动调用我们安装好的xftp工具: 

    13,如果已经注册过邮箱了则直接登录,没有的话进行注册,点提交

    14,点确定即可,然后去邮箱进行认证一下

    15,安装完成,现在可以通过拖动的方式可以传输文件了 

  • 相关阅读:
    MySQL 8.0 OCP (1Z0-908) 考点精析-架构考点5:数据字典(Data Dictionary)
    DOE认证是什么
    Docker在Centos7下的安装
    MySQL调优篇:单机数据库如何在高并发场景下健步如飞?
    冰蝎工具开发实现动态二进制加密WebShell
    Jmeter系列-定时器Timers的基本介绍(11)
    C语言for循环必备练习题
    蓝桥杯(七段码,C++)
    拒绝访问硬盘拒绝访问的找回方法
    《MATLAB 神经网络43个案例分析》:第36章 遗传算法优化计算——建模自变量降维
  • 原文地址:https://blog.csdn.net/m0_67844671/article/details/133616010
  • 最新文章
  • 攻防演习之三天拿下官网站群
    数据安全治理学习——前期安全规划和安全管理体系建设
    企业安全 | 企业内一次钓鱼演练准备过程
    内网渗透测试 | Kerberos协议及其部分攻击手法
    0day的产生 | 不懂代码的"代码审计"
    安装scrcpy-client模块av模块异常,环境问题解决方案
    leetcode hot100【LeetCode 279. 完全平方数】java实现
    OpenWrt下安装Mosquitto
    AnatoMask论文汇总
    【AI日记】24.11.01 LangChain、openai api和github copilot
  • 热门文章
  • 十款代码表白小特效 一个比一个浪漫 赶紧收藏起来吧!!!
    奉劝各位学弟学妹们,该打造你的技术影响力了!
    五年了,我在 CSDN 的两个一百万。
    Java俄罗斯方块,老程序员花了一个周末,连接中学年代!
    面试官都震惊,你这网络基础可以啊!
    你真的会用百度吗?我不信 — 那些不为人知的搜索引擎语法
    心情不好的时候,用 Python 画棵樱花树送给自己吧
    通宵一晚做出来的一款类似CS的第一人称射击游戏Demo!原来做游戏也不是很难,连憨憨学妹都学会了!
    13 万字 C 语言从入门到精通保姆级教程2021 年版
    10行代码集2000张美女图,Python爬虫120例,再上征途
Copyright © 2022 侵权请联系2656653265@qq.com    京ICP备2022015340号-1
正则表达式工具 cron表达式工具 密码生成工具

京公网安备 11010502049817号